It's Time to Be Screen Smart! (April 29th-May 5th)

According to The Early Years Institute, "Children, today, spend an average of more than 7 hours a day in front of screen media, with only 16 minutes every day playing creatively and only 4 to 7 minutes outside per day."

This week, join in the national celebration with children, families, schools and communities everywhere to reduce screen-based entertainment media and turn on life! Play, create, explore and spend time with family and friends.
